The opportunity has arisen for us to advertise for a Team Clerical Officer within our Deprivation of Liberty Team within Adult Social Services.
This exciting role involves working closely with the Team Manager, Seniors and Social Workers within the team.
You will be working alongside other business support within the team providing administrative support including, processing referrals, liaising with GPs, raising orders and processing invoices. You will be required to update and input information into the Authority's IT (WCCIS) database.
We are looking for highly organised individuals who can work well in a busy and team setting. Candidates need to be highly skilled in MS Office, able to work under pressure and work to deadlines.
This is a permanent full-time 37-hour post.
